[eth(yl) + oxy-2 (+ -(y)l)]oxy- is a combining form representing oxygen in compound words, sometimes as an equivalent of hydroxy-. Other words that use the affix oxy- include: oxychloride, oxymorphone, oxysalt, oxytetracycline, phenoxybenzamine
